THE RELENTLESS – FOR SHE IS MADE OF THE STAR STUFF





Arriving the world after a long scream,
She lies peacefully in her cradle,
A kingdom which she owned,
She could feel the bliss,
Days passed by the princess started crawling,
As if every piece of the land belonged to her,
Hard playing and harder sleeping all day long,
Trusting everyone who kissed her innocent face,
No reality hitting her, she grows as the most secure and happy kid,
Stiffly ironed pinafores and skirts,
Reciting poems and feeling proud,
Appreciated for being naughty and active,
She thought life is so immaculate.
Her dream starts growing and so does she,
Achieving in all places that she stepped into because she didn't learn the word impossible back then,
Muddy shoes defined her beauty,
Those golds, silver, and bronze on her chest,
The princess walks back to her castle,
Happy to see her parent's eyes glitter in pride,
So, satisfied she lies on the bed, a peaceful sleep….

Being an adult reality gushes into one's body without consciousness,
We differentiate everything into possible or impossible, easy or difficult, right and wrong…
People who were quite start speaking about the grown up,
She feels supernatural, as if growing up was a fault, thoughts taunting,
She anyways continued,
And then echoes of their voices amplified,
She feared if something will stop her but never revealed it in action,
She anyways continued, days were hard, people dumped negativity and wanted her to be one among all, wanted her to stop and settle down.
She got furious, trying to fight and explain, they said she isn't good,
People who had pampered her is no more in her journey,
Her nightmares are terrible, tears wetting the pillow,
she doubts her journey at times but something still wants her to persist,
Nobody to comfort when she wanted it the most,
Breathing was getting harder,
She still dresses up and continues for the next day,
She realizes she need not explain people about her journey and why it was important to her,
She moves on discovering herself,
She could once again feel the bliss,
Connected to the universe inside and outside her, she continues…

-Sangeetha Priya I

BELIEVE IN THYSELF









When folks tell you, your fate controls your destiny,
Ask god then why did you create me?
Ask thyself if the divine being has a tale written for you and if he has tossed you on the planet with a thread in his hand

As a child when you badly wanted to have an ice-cream all you did was find a shop and get it. If you didn't find the shop that day you kept searching for a new place where you could get it and have it. Have you ever blamed your fate or felt that you were not destined to have an ice-cream! You knew you could always try and get it sometime.

Then why is the proportionality inverse between age and belief?
Then why blame the stars, the gods, the situations, the fellow humans around you for what you can’t get for yourself in life as you grow up?

If the constellation of the stars,
the arrangement of the planets,
movement of heavenly bodies,
the lines on your palm and scriptures that exist for it,
the chromaticity of your skin,
the caste, race, and religion you belong to have an influence on what you want for yourself and what you want to do to the world,

Ask thyself why were you descended to this holy sphere!

You are not designed to be a marionette!!

You are a unique power born to make an impact you wish to create!!!

When you trust yourself, and take charge the atoms and molecules in you will obey your commands.

Fate is not an obligation for what you could not accomplish. 

Believe in thyself, for the belief in thou is the belief in the almighty.
